Its homeowners coverage meets core needs, and shoppers can pair policies with targeted endorsements (e.g., water backup, service line) common in the region\u2019s risk profile.\n            <\/div>\n        <\/div>\n\n    <\/div>\n\n    <div class=\"b-mini-review__bottom-content\">\n        <div class=\"b-mini-review__pros-cons-list-wrapper\">\n            <h4 class=\"b-mini-review__subtitle\">Pros<\/h4>\n            <ul class=\"b-mini-review__pros-cons-list b-mini-review__pros-cons-list_pros\">\n                            <li>Discounts<\/li>\n                            <li>Online resources <\/li>\n                            <li>Affordable prices<\/li>\n                        <\/ul>\n\n                    <\/div>\n                    <div class=\"b-mini-review__pros-cons-list-wrapper\">\n                <h4 class=\"b-mini-review__subtitle\">Cons<\/h4>\n                <ul class=\"b-mini-review__pros-cons-list b-mini-review__pros-cons-list_cons\">\n                                    <li>Coverage breadth varies by policy; compare endorsements<\/li>\n                                <\/ul>\n            <\/div>\n        \n        <div class=\"b-mini-review__desc-wrapper \">\n            <div class=\"b-mini-review__accordion-header\">\n                <span class=\"b-mini-review__accordion-text\">Read More<\/span>\n            <\/div>\n            <div class=\"b-mini-review__accordion-content\">\n                            <h4 class=\"b-mini-review__subtitle\">Available discounts<\/h4>\n                <div> <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Educator discount<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Protection device discount<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Sprinkler discount<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Claims-free discount<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Fire-resistive construction discount<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n <\/div>\n                            <h4 class=\"b-mini-review__subtitle\">Unique features<\/h4>\n                <div> <p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Pemco has an <\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">online resources center <\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">which includes articles on how to protect your home from common damages and how to choose a contractor for home repairs.<\/span><\/p>\n <\/div>\n                        <div>\n        <\/div>\n    <\/div>\n<\/section>\n\n\n            <span class=\"b-toc-anchor\" id=\"cost1\" title=\"Average Cost of Homeowners Insurance in Washington\"><\/span>\n    \n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Average Cost of Homeowners Insurance in Washington<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Authoritative averages from the National Association of Insurance Commissioners show Washington\u2019s typical homeowners expenditure in 2022 was in the low-$1,200s, compared with roughly the low-$1,400s for the U.S. as a whole (<a href=\"https:\/\/www.iii.org\/fact-statistic\/average-homeowners-insurance-premiums-by-state\">III\/NAIC<\/a>; see the NAIC Homeowners Insurance Report at <a href=\"https:\/\/content.naic.org\/\">NAIC<\/a>). More current 2025 quote-based studies commonly place a standard Washington policy in the low-to-mid $1,000s annually, while national estimates are often mid-$1,700s to low-$2,000s depending on coverage assumptions (<a href=\"https:\/\/www.bankrate.com\">Bankrate<\/a>; <a href=\"https:\/\/www.nerdwallet.com\">NerdWallet<\/a>). Premiums have risen since 2021 amid construction-cost inflation and catastrophe losses; the BLS household insurance CPI confirms sustained increases (<a href=\"https:\/\/data.bls.gov\/timeseries\/CUUR0000SEHF\">BLS CPI<\/a>). Your price will vary by home characteristics and location (for example, Seattle vs. Winthrop or Quincy).<\/p>\n\n\n            <span class=\"b-toc-anchor\" id=\"add-ons\" title=\"Home Insurance Add-Ons That Will Further Protect You\"><\/span>\n    \n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Home Insurance Add-Ons That May Further Protect You<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Washington homeowners will want to prepare for <a class=\"achor-toggles\" href=\"https:\/\/www.reviews.com\/insurance\/homeowners\/how-to-protect-your-home-from-extreme-weather\/\">weather-related eventualities<\/a>. In wildfire-exposed areas, combine coverage with home-hardening and defensible space per standards from <a href=\"https:\/\/ibhs.org\/wildfire\/wildfire-prepared-home\/\">IBHS Wildfire Prepared Home<\/a> and state guidance from the <a href=\"https:\/\/www.insurance.wa.gov\">Washington OIC<\/a>.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>In areas of the state that have heavy rains, homeowners may want to consider <a class=\"achor-toggles\" href=\"https:\/\/www.reviews.com\/insurance\/homeowners\/what-is-flood-insurance\/\">flood insurance<\/a>. It\u2019s relatively easy to purchase a flood insurance policy through the National Flood Insurance Program (NFIP). Your private insurer may also be able to help you purchase a flood insurance policy. Standard homeowners policies exclude flood; NFIP residential limits are up to $250,000 for the building and $100,000 for contents, there is no Additional Living Expenses coverage, and new policies typically have a 30\u2011day waiting period. Under FEMA\u2019s Risk Rating 2.0, most annual premium increases for renewals are capped (generally up to 18%). See <a href=\"https:\/\/www.fema.gov\">NFIP Summary of Coverage<\/a> and <a href=\"https:\/\/www.fema.gov\/flood-insurance\/risk-rating\">Risk Rating 2.0<\/a>, and the OIC\u2019s <a href=\"https:\/\/www.insurance.wa.gov\/flood-insurance\">flood insurance<\/a> page.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Additionally, Washington homeowners in the central and eastern parts of the state have had to deal with <a href=\"https:\/\/www.heraldnet.com\/northwest\/more-evacuations-as-wildfire-in-central-washington-grows\/\" target=\"_blank\" aria-label=\" (opens in a new tab)\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ener nofollow\" class=\"achor-toggles\">increasing fire dangers<\/a> in recent years. If you live in these areas, you may want to review your policy and check that your coverage includes adequate replacement coverage in case of fire. Review extended replacement cost, ordinance or law, debris removal\/landscaping sublimits, and adequate loss of use duration (12\u201324 months). For mitigation and availability guidance, see the OIC\u2019s page on <a href=\"https:\/\/www.insurance.wa.gov\">wildfires and insurance<\/a> and IBHS\u2019s <a href=\"https:\/\/ibhs.org\/wildfire\/wildfire-prepared-home\/\">Wildfire Prepared Home<\/a>.<\/p>\n\n\n            <span class=\"b-toc-anchor\" id=\"cheap\" title=\"The Cheapest Homeowner Insurance Companies in Washington\"><\/span>\n    \n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">The Cheapest Homeowner Insurance Companies in Washington (historical sample figures; see Methodology)<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-table table table-striped table-bordered table--bordered-top\"><table class=\"\"><tbody><tr><td><strong>Companies<\/strong><\/td><td><strong>Average Annual Premium for $200K Dwelling Coverage (historical sample)<\/strong><\/td><\/tr><tr><td>PEMCO<\/td><td>$422<\/td><\/tr><tr><td>Mutual of Enumclaw&nbsp;<\/td><td>$539<\/td><\/tr><tr><td>Grange<\/td><td>$555<\/td><\/tr><tr><td>Nationwide&nbsp;<\/td><td>$613<\/td><\/tr><tr><td>Oregon Mutual<\/td><td>$802<\/td><\/tr><tr><td>Travelers<\/td><td>$875<\/td><\/tr><tr><td>Privilege Underwriters Reciprocal Exchange (PURE)<\/td><td>$1,130<\/td><\/tr><tr><td>USAA<\/td><td>$1,193<\/td><\/tr><tr><td>State Farm&nbsp;<\/td><td>$1,264<\/td><\/tr><tr><td>Farmers<\/td><td>$1,349<\/td><\/tr><tr><td>Allstate<\/td><td>$1,393<\/td><\/tr><tr><td>Chubb&nbsp;<\/td><td>$1,893<\/td><\/tr><\/tbody><\/table><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Top 3 Cheapest Homeowners Insurance Companies in Washington&nbsp;<span style=\"font-weight:400\">(historical sample; for context only)<\/span><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<ul><li>PEMCO \u2013 $422<\/li><li>Mutual of Enumclaw \u2013 $539<\/li><li>Grange \u2013 $555<\/li><\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Top 3 Most Expensive Homeowners Insurance Companies in Washington <span style=\"font-weight:400\">(historical sample; for context only)<\/span><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<ul><li>Chubb \u2013 $1,893<\/li><li>Allstate \u2013 $1,393<\/li><li>Farmers \u2013 $1,349<\/li><\/ul>\n\n\n            <span class=\"b-toc-anchor\" id=\"help\" title=\"Helpful Resources for Washington Homeowners\"><\/span>\n    \n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Helpful Resources for Washington Homeowners<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>The Office of the <a href=\"https:\/\/www.insurance.wa.gov\/\" target=\"_blank\" aria-label=\" (opens in a new tab)\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ener nofollow\" class=\"achor-toggles\">Insurance Commissioner<\/a> for Washington State has a number of helpful resources for those interested in buying homeowners insurance.
